Home > Error Log > Virtualhost Php Error Log

Virtualhost Php Error Log


asked 8 years ago viewed 70347 times active 4 months ago Blog Stack Overflow Podcast #93 - A Very Spolsky Halloween Special Visit Chat Linked 3 no php error logging on Close this window and log in. Why didn’t Japan attack the West Coast of the United States during World War II? Was user-agent identification used for some scripting attack techique? have a peek here

some of that defaults automatically to working at CLI but has to be enabled when running in a web server. –PurplePilot Nov 21 '11 at 9:53 For example what Resources Join | Indeed Jobs | Advertise Copyright © 1998-2016, Inc. This is particularly useful for modules such as mod_proxy or mod_rewrite where you want to know details about what it's trying to do. You say the log is created and everything, it would have the same permissions since it is created by the same user in the log dir.

Apache Virtual Host Error Log

the php module stays alive within Apache for the lifetime of Apache, and keeps the error log open, even after the privs drop. DELETE any old "php.ini" files from "C:\WINDOWS"
and other directories.
5. Join them; it only takes a minute: Sign up Here's how it works: Anybody can ask a question Anybody can answer The best answers are voted up and rise to the This gives the site that the client reports having been referred from. (This should be the page that links to or includes /apache_pb.gif). "Mozilla/4.08 [en] (Win98; I ;Nav)" (\"%{User-agent}i\") The User-Agent

However, in order to accomplish this, the server must continue to write to the old log files while it finishes serving old requests. LogFormat "%v %l %u %t \"%r\" %>s %b" comonvhost CustomLog logs/access_log comonvhost The %v is used to log the name of the virtual host that is serving the request. share|improve this answer answered Jul 18 '13 at 13:54 popas 352510 add a comment| up vote 1 down vote In the past, I had no error logs in two cases: The Apache Customlog Combined Access Log Related ModulesRelated Directivesmod_log_config href="./mod/mod_setenvif.html">mod_setenvifCustomLogLogFormatSetEnvIf The server access log records all requests processed by the server.

However you can simply log to stderr however you will have to do all message assembly:

LogToApache($Message) {
$stderr = fopen('php://stderr', 'w');
Php_value Error_log You will see that the apache error log is outside of the php error log. How to defeat the elven insects using modern technology? you could check here it's a very simliar name, in fact, but slightly different (the php error log file should have the word "php" in it, to distinguish it).

This is the Apache error log, could it be? Display_startup_errors share|improve this answer edited Dec 12 '15 at 21:53 Community♦ 1 answered Sep 7 '12 at 23:13 Nikolay Chuprina 48144 perfect step-by-step solution –Mark Fox Feb 15 '14 at RE: different PHP error log for each virtualhost in apache 2? the relinquishing of root privs is only done AFTER all startup activities are finished. –Marc B Sep 24 '12 at 14:30 @MarcB but the php logger does not log

Php_value Error_log

Overriding this setting in the of the httpd.conf does not seem to do anything. Given that ice is less dense than water, why doesn't it sit completely atop water (rather than slightly submerged)? Apache Virtual Host Error Log Close Box Join Tek-Tips Today! Php_value Error_reporting How to log errors The error_reporting configuration option controls what level of errors are reported, and also what level of errors will be logged to the error log.

However, this configuration is not recommended since it can significantly slow the server. E_ALL = "30719" right now. –ReactiveRaven Mar 8 '12 at 16:26 2 Since "error_reporting" values keep changing and since you can't use PHP constants like "E_ALL" and "E_STRICT" outside of Which is the most acceptable numeral for 1980 to 1989? Did I overlook something? Apache Customlog

It never attempts to write to the pre-existing empty file, just fails on folder creation. Starting freelancer career while already having customers Produce Dürer's magic square Interlace strings What is the purpose of the box between the engines of an A-10? message обрезается по null-символу. Подсказка message не должен содержать null-символ. Учтите, что message может передаваться в файл, по почте, в syslog, и т.д.. Используйте подходящую преобразующую или экранирующую функцию, base64_encode(), rawurlencode() Then a program like split-logfile can be used to post-process the access log in order to split it into one file per virtual host.

Also make sure you put php_flag log_errors on share|improve this answer edited Dec 16 '13 at 12:07 Sandesh 82721137 answered Apr 2 '10 at 20:50 rkulla 1,88511114 Interesting. Apache Log Rotation Then the env= clause of the CustomLog directive is used to include or exclude requests where the environment variable is set. On Unix systems, you can accomplish this using: tail -f error_log Per-module logging The LogLevel directive allows you to specify a log severity level on a per-module basis.

asked 3 months ago viewed 96 times active 3 months ago Blog Stack Overflow Podcast #93 - A Very Spolsky Halloween Special Related 6php writing deprecated errors to apache error log9Apache

For compatibility reasons with Apache 2.2 the notation "||" is also supported and equivalent to using "|". What happens to all of the options when they expire? This document describes how to configure its logging capabilities, and how to understand what the logs contain. Php.ini Error Log The filename for the access log is relative to the ServerRoot unless it begins with a slash.

Click Here to join Tek-Tips and talk with other members! More information is available in the mod_cgi documentation. php_value error_log /usr/local/zend/var/log/my_host_php_error.log and Just open /etc/apache2/mods-enabled/php5.load this file and check if below line is uncommented. Available Languages: en | fr | ja | ko | tr CommentsNotice:This is not a Q&A section.

The format is specified using a format string that looks much like a C-style printf(1) format string. Just add "Content-Type: text/html; charset=ISO-8859-1" into extra_header string. Various versions of Apache httpd have used other modules and directives to control access logging, including mod_log_referer, mod_log_agent, and the TransferLog directive. In other cases, a literal "-" will be logged instead.

I think everyone would agree that there should be a log file, displaying in the browser is only a temporary solution. –Rene Koller Sep 25 '12 at 8:08 For Ask the best questions!TANSTAAFL!! Date("r") . "\t$ip\t$file\t$class\t$usr\t$msg\r\n");
} else {
print "Unable Did I overlook something?

Right-click My Computer and select Properties to bring
up the Computer Properties dialog. For example, the format string "%m %U%q %H" will log the method, path, query-string, and protocol, resulting in exactly the same output as "%r". 200 (%>s) This is the status code Comments placed here should be pointed towards suggestions on improving the documentation or server, and may be removed again by our moderators if they are either implemented or considered invalid/off-topic. LogFormat "%h %l %u %t \"%r\" %>s %b \"%{Referer}i\" \"%{User-agent}i\"" combined CustomLog log/access_log combined This format is exactly the same as the Common Log Format, with the addition of two more

Once PHP has written to its self-created file successfully, it will append to the file on new errors. The Apache HTTP Server provides very comprehensive and flexible logging capabilities. LogFormat "%h %l %u %t \"%r\" %>s %b" common CustomLog logs/access_log common This defines the nickname common and associates it with a particular log format string. destination Назначение. Устанавливается в зависимости от параметра message_type.